## What is the Action of Zeno's Paradox?

The Zeno's Paradox, when applied to cryptocurrency trading, highlights the illusion of infinite divisibility within discrete actions. Consider a perpetual trading loop – placing an order, executing it, adjusting parameters, and repeating – each iteration seemingly approaching a theoretical optimal outcome but never quite reaching it. This mirrors the paradox's core: an infinite series of actions, each smaller than the last, should theoretically take an infinite time, yet we experience them as finite. Consequently, traders must acknowledge the practical limitations of iterative refinement and accept that diminishing returns eventually set in, regardless of algorithmic sophistication.

## What is the Adjustment of Zeno's Paradox?

In options trading and financial derivatives, the paradox manifests in the continuous recalibration of hedging strategies. A delta-hedging strategy, for instance, requires constant adjustments to maintain a neutral position as the underlying asset's price fluctuates. While each adjustment aims to minimize risk, the infinite series of adjustments theoretically demands infinite resources and time, an impossibility in real-world markets. This underscores the importance of transaction costs and market impact, factors often overlooked in idealized models, and necessitates a pragmatic approach to risk management.

## What is the Algorithm of Zeno's Paradox?

The application of algorithmic trading to Zeno's Paradox reveals the inherent limitations of automated systems. An algorithm designed to exploit micro-price discrepancies, for example, might theoretically generate infinite profits by executing an infinite number of trades. However, latency, slippage, and exchange fees introduce practical constraints, preventing the algorithm from achieving this theoretical ideal. Therefore, algorithmic design must incorporate these real-world frictions, recognizing that continuous optimization can only yield finite, and diminishing, returns.
